Output 31308961b504c75c8c0ba7eae4ed02ee85c1f23afb57d31fae3071d75af92a85:3

value
22433
script pubkey
OP_0 OP_PUSHBYTES_20 26b819c8787f7146d6cdd21d9bac0e70d4fd06e7
address
bc1qy6upnjrc0ac5d4kd6gwehtqwwr206ph84zauwg
transaction
31308961b504c75c8c0ba7eae4ed02ee85c1f23afb57d31fae3071d75af92a85
spent
false

1 Sat Range